WEKIVA PARKWAY PROJECT IN MOUNT DORA
This 25-mile toll road project, an extension of SR 429, will connect Lake County to metropolitan Orlando. The completed beltway will connect to State Road 417 and finish the beltway around Central Florida. This estimated $1.6 billion project will conveniently link north Lake County to Seminole and Orange Counties and reduce traffic and travel times. Construction on the Mount Dora sections is scheduled to begin in late summer or fall of 2017 and finish in 2019. The overall parkway should be open to traffic by the end of 2021.

1. Bird's eye view of the US 441 and State Road 46 interchange, which will be rebuilt as a signalized intersection with a flyover ramp. The flyover ramp will accommodate motorists heading south on US 441 who want to go east on SR 46 toward the parkway. US 441 is shown here left to right; SR 46 runs top to bottom of this image.
